Electric car charging point. Parking 75m away, unloading at the door. No smoking.. Tucked up the end of a small and private lane nestles The Smithy, a quaint detached stone built cottage. Originally built in the 1850’s, this charming property now offers a cosy retreat for couples within walking distance of the facilities within the picturesque village of Ovington set within the Tyne Valley. Ovington is situated just over a mile from Prudhoe, where there is a Riverside Country Park on the banks of the river Tyne close by. Prudhoe sits equidistant between Hexham to the west and Gateshead to the east; both being 13 miles.
